Here are the top reasons your website isn't converting and quick, actionable solutions to fix it fast:
1. Unclear Value Proposition
Visitors should immediately understand what you offer and why it's beneficial. If your homepage doesn't clearly convey this within seconds, potential customers will leave.
Quick Fix: Highlight a clear, compelling headline and sub-headline at the top of your homepage. Clearly state your unique value and the immediate benefit visitors receive from your business.
2. Poor User Experience (UX)
If navigating your website feels complicated or confusing, visitors won't stick around. Issues like slow load times, cluttered design, and poor mobile responsiveness discourage visitors from engaging.
Quick Fix: Improve loading speed, simplify navigation menus, and ensure your website design is clean and mobile-friendly. User-friendly sites keep visitors engaged longer, increasing conversion chances.
3. Weak or Missing Call-to-Action (CTA)
A strong CTA guides visitors toward the next step clearly and persuasively. If your site lacks compelling CTAs, visitors won’t know what actions to take.
Quick Fix: Use concise, action-oriented language for your CTAs, such as "Book Your Free Consultation," "Get Your Quote," or "Sign Up Now." Place these strategically throughout your pages to maximize conversions.
4. Lack of Trust and Credibility
Visitors won't convert if they don't trust your website. Trust indicators include reviews, testimonials, security badges, and clear contact information.
Quick Fix: Incorporate testimonials, showcase client logos, and prominently display security certifications. Make your contact details visible and accessible to build immediate trust.
5. Irrelevant or Low-Quality Content
Content that doesn’t resonate with your visitors or fails to address their specific pain points won't drive conversions.
Quick Fix: Provide content tailored specifically to your target audience's interests and needs. Regularly update your blog with valuable, informative content that positions you as an expert in your field.
By swiftly addressing these common issues, you'll create a seamless journey for your visitors, significantly increasing your website's conversion rate.
